共计 2791 个字符,预计需要花费 7 分钟才能阅读完成。
输入 ai 可见
1、操作系统 Ubuntu 2404 LTSC
2、硬件平台
2.1、i9-13950HX、DDR5 32GB、RTX 3500 Ada Laptop 12GB
3、部署流程
3.1、卸载系统自带的 NVIDIA 驱动
3.2、添加 NVIDIA 仓库
3.3、安装最新版的 NVIDIA 驱动与 CUDA
3.3.1、检查 NVIDIA 驱动与 CUDA
3.4、安装 Docker 检查 Docker 是否正确安装
3.5、安装 Ollama for Docker
3.5.1、在 Docker 拉去 Ollama Image
3.6、直接拉取 Ollama 适用的 Deepseek 模型
3.7、浏览器运行 Deepseek
4、其它
4.1、可以随意替换 Ollama 的 Deepseek 模型,只要你硬件够强大
3.1 卸载系统自带的驱动
sudo apt purge *nvidia* *cuda* *cudnn* -y
sudo apt autoremove -y
sudo apt clean
reboot
添加官方 NVIDIA 依赖
sudo apt update && sudo apt install -y build-essential dkms linux-headers-$(uname -r)
nvidia-container-toolkit
NVIDIA Container Toolkit
curl -fsSL https://nvidia.github.io/libnvidia-container/gpgkey | sudo gpg --dearmor -o /usr/share/keyrings/nvidia-container-toolkit-keyring.gpg \
&& curl -s -L https://nvidia.github.io/libnvidia-container/stable/deb/nvidia-container-toolkit.list | \
sed 's#deb https://#deb [signed-by=/usr/share/keyrings/nvidia-container-toolkit-keyring.gpg] https://#g' | \
sudo tee /etc/apt/sources.list.d/nvidia-container-toolkit.list
sed -i -e '/experimental/ s/^#//g' /etc/apt/sources.list.d/nvidia-container-toolkit.list
sudo apt-get update
sudo apt-get install -y nvidia-container-toolkit
# sudo nano /etc/docker/daemon.json
{
"runtimes": {
"nvidia": {
"path": "nvidia-container-runtime",
"runtimeArgs": []}
},
"default-runtime": "nvidia"
}
添加 NVIDIA 仓库
sudo apt install -y software-properties-common
sudo add-apt-repository -y ppa:graphics-drivers/ppa
sudo apt update
reboot
安装驱动和 CUDA (最新稳定版)
文件名称:NVIDIA-Linux-x86_64-570.144.run
文件大小:376MB
下载声明:本站部分资源来自于网络收集,若侵犯了你的隐私或版权,请及时联系我们删除有关信息。
下载地址:https://cn.download.nvidia.com/XFree86/Linux-x86_64/570.144/NVIDIA-Linux-x86_64-570.144.run
文件名称:cuda_12.8.1_570.124.06_linux.run
文件大小:5.4GB / 5500MB
下载声明:本站部分资源来自于网络收集,若侵犯了你的隐私或版权,请及时联系我们删除有关信息。
下载地址:wget https://developer.download.nvidia.com/compute/cuda/12.8.1/local_installers/cuda_12.8.1_570.124.06_linux.run
sudo apt install -y nvidia-driver-570
sudo apt install -y nvidia-cuda-toolkit
reboot
验证 NVIDIA 驱动、CUDA 版本
# 检查驱动 nvidia-smi
检查 CUDA 版本
nvcc --version
检查 CUDA 设备
nvidia-smi -q | grep -i "cuda"
如果你想每秒都知道 GPU 运作情况,请运行
watch -n 1 nvidia-smi
ubuntu 2404 开始安裝 Docker
sudo apt update
sudo apt upgrade -y
安装必要的依赖包
sudo apt install -y apt-transport-https ca-certificates curl gnupg-agent software-properties-common
添加 Docker 的官方 GPG 密钥
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/trusted.gpg.d/docker.gpg
添加 Docker 的 APT 软件源
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"
sudo apt update
sudo apt upgrade -y
安装 Docker Engine 和 Docker Compose
sudo apt install -y docker-ce docker-ce-cli containerd.io
验证 Docker 是否安装成功
sudo docker --version
sudo docker run hello-world
docker ps -a
将当前用户添加到 Docker 用户组(可选) sudo usermod -aG docker ${USER}
正文完